WebPartial salpingectomy is removal of part of the fallopian tube. Complete salpingectomy is a procedure to completely remove one (unilateral) or both (bilateral) fallopian tubes. WebFeb 10, 2024 · Overview. Tubal ligation — also known as having your tubes tied or tubal sterilization — is a type of permanent birth control. During tubal ligation, the fallopian … WebAug 28, 2024 · Laparoscopy is a type of surgery that can be used to examine the reproductive organs. Small incisions are made and a camera is inserted into the abdomen. This allows the healthcare provider to physically see the outside of the fallopian tubes and whether there appear to be any blockages or damage.
